The History of Pound Cake

Pound cake first showed up in England and America in the 1700s. People loved it because it was thick, buttery, and had simple stuff in it. The name “pound cake” comes from how people made it back then – they used a pound each of flour, sugar, butter, and eggs. This made a rich cake that filled you up, and it became a hit.

Blueberry Pound Cake Recipe

This Blueberry Pound Cake is made with fresh, juicy berries and baked in a Bundt pan. Enjoy a sweet slice for breakfast, with afternoon tea, or with ice cream for dessert.

  • Total Time: 90 minutes
  • Yield: 14 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 ¼ cups white sugar, divided
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 2 cups fresh blueberries
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 325°F (165°C). Grease a 10-inch fluted tube pan (such as Bundt) with 2 tablespoons softened butter. Sprinkle ¼ cup sugar into the pan and tilt gently to coat.
  2. Prepare Dry Ingredients: Mix 2 ¾ cups flour, baking powder, and salt together in a bowl. Toss blueberries and remaining ¼ cup flour together in another bowl until coated.
  3. Cream Butter and Sugar: In a large bowl, cream the remaining 2 cups sugar and 1 cup butter with an electric mixer until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in vanilla extract.
  4. Combine and Fold: Gradually beat in the flour mixture, then fold in the floured blueberries. Pour the batter into the prepared pan.
  5. Bake: Bake in the preheated oven until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ean, about 70 to 80 minutes.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then turn out onto a wire rack and cool completely.

Notes

  • Coating Blueberries: Coating the blueberries with flour helps to keep them from sinking to the bottom of the cake.
  •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ature before mixing for a smoother batter.
  • Storing: Store the c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or refrigerate for up to a week.

How to Store and Freeze Your Blueberry Pound Cake

To keep your homemade blueberry pound cake fresh and moist is important to enjoy it later. I’ll give you some advice to make sure your cake stays delicious for a few days or for future parties.

How to Keep It Juicy and Fresh

Put your blueberry pound cake in a closed container at room temperature. This stops it from getting dry. If you plan to eat it within a few days, wrap it up in plastic or foil.

To store it for a longer time, stick it in the freezer. Cover the cake or slices with plastic or foil then put them in a freezer bag or tight container. In the freezer, your cake can stay good for up to 3 months. Just let it warm up to room temperature before you eat it.

Always keep your blueberry pound cake away from the sun and heat. This helps it stay moist and yummy.
